Output 50c9375113ac0703eb98a17f0db7d2ea99820ed2afe115a6895ec6756cdc8a62:5

value
139850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ec62d16ef25798f489b52f33b760303f32f340c OP_EQUALVERIFY OP_CHECKSIG
address
16ivJQvaK69TX4WaasS2mRPZVwNV6WmyWd
transaction
50c9375113ac0703eb98a17f0db7d2ea99820ed2afe115a6895ec6756cdc8a62
confirmations
371841
spent
true